Biography

Eken Mine (峰 恵研, Mine Eken, February 15, 1935 - February 6, 2002) was a Japanese actor and voice actor from Nagasaki Prefecture. He was affiliated with Theater Echo since 1961. His wife was fellow voice actress Hiroko Maruyama (丸山 裕子, Maruyama Hiroko).

He mainly worked on dubbing Western movies. In anime, he mostly played characters of older men, villains, mild-mannered and father roles. He died of heart failure on February 6, 2002. He was 66 years old.
